CVS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2023 in Review

2,258 of the 6,860 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in CVS Health (CVS) for Q4 2023, worth a combined $82.8B — up 18% from $70B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 305 funds opened new CVS positions and 126 closed out — a net gain of 179 holders — while 666 added to existing stakes and 1,094 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Morgan Stanley, adding an estimated $2.14B. The largest seller was Two Sigma Investments, cutting an estimated $137M.
